I can’t lie, I booked the room before reading any reviews (some plans changed and I had to find something else asap), so after looking through them I expected a terrible experience. I brought disinfectant, blankets, sheets, paper towels, etc just in case. Before I brought my things inside I examined the room with a flashlight. And I saw nothing amiss. It wasn’t perfect or fancy but I didn’t see anything gross. No bugs or even dust. No funky smell. It was perfectly adequate. I even walked around barefoot and my feet didn’t get dirty. The shower pressure/temp was fine. It had nice lighting in the headboard and above the nightstands, dimmable with outlets and USB ports. Our room was on the first floor if that makes any difference. The downsides: parking after like 7 pm is atrocious. We returned late from an event and there was only one spot in the entire parking lot, way far away from our room. The bed is kinda hard but it’s fine for a couple nights. They only gave us two flat pillows on a king size bed so make sure to bring some if needed. No breakfast or anything, just coffee in the lobby. Wi-Fi was very spotty. But really the only thing that bothered me was the indoor pool. It was murky and cold. Kind of a let down, I was excited to swim. My partner went down the water slide and it was very slow, but he’s also a 200+ lb man and I would assume the slide is meant for children so take that as you will. It has so much potential to be a nice little pool but it’s clearly not maintained. So that was a bummer. The hot tub was “closed for maintenance” but according to reviews it’s been closed for some months. All in all, I expected a disgusting horrible room after reading the reviews but what I got was fine. It was overpriced for what it is, a small standard motel room. But it’s not the worst option in the area.

I wanted to like this place, but I just cannot recommend this motel to anyone for the following reasons:

  1. The check-in process is antiquated and hard to follow. I had to call and request for them to provide a verbal confirmation number because the system didn't provide one. In fact, we didn't get ANY confirmation that our rooms were reserved on the dates we needed until we called back a third time.
  2. The room was $120.00/ night and that is the going rate for most of the hotels in the area (such as the Best Western right next door) and those hotels are head and shoulders nicer and better in every conceivable way. At check-in the manager charged me more per night because I had 2 children and 2 adults even though that is exactly what I typed in when I reserved the rooms months ago.
  3. The room smelled of Ben-gay and badly needed updating. The carpet was frayed and ruined in several spots, the refrigerator did not work, a lot of the decor was broken or damaged, and the hot water was spotty at best even during off peak times.
  4. The rooms were badly insulated around the door especially as you could see daylight around most of the door frame. Not only did this make us feel a bit unsafe, it also allowed a lot of the road noise to come in as well.
  5. Even though I had been bamboozled to pay more for the extra child at check-in, we were NEVER provided enough towels and had to ask twice for extra pillows. The first night when my wife asked for extra pillows the jerk at the front desk wouldn't give her any. The next day I had to go again to the front and demand 4 more pillows or I was leaving, period. They did finally provide them, but does it have to come to threats to properly equip a room? When my daughter asked for more towels because they had not been replaced the previous day by housekeeping they demanded for them to be first brought to the front before they would provided more. The next day I did indeed bring them to the front and deposited them in the middle of the lobby. They acted like they didn't know what I was talking about, but my daughter confirmed it was same piece of trash from last night. Regardless, they promptly gave us more towels, but they smelled funny. Obviously they don't use bleach. Again, why the run-around for more towels?
  6. This property is obviously struggling and in all fairness it should be! The management needs to be replaced at the very least and the entire facility needs updated and better maintenance. Instead of a quaint, cute, reasonably priced motel, you are left with a dump. There are FAR BETTER places to stay right around the corner for the same if not cheaper price. This property's days are obviously numbered and as I said, they deserve to be. I do not recommend this motel under any circumstance. You are wasting your money and precious vacation time for a bad experience.
